(Writing for phone I am in a hospital for months now so there may be errors I cant work with a phone well)
Here is an idea for a project for you hardware people.
The dongle hardware would have an ethernet port and in software a simple GUI client between the two as the middle for both hosts, players (create game - join game) The hosts would make the room and the player would signal the start of the game with the join.
I realized that the console might also need a pc to passthrough the connection otherwise anyone could join anytime and players wouldn't know who is online for each client, with the pc you could do more have battle history, usernames, score exetera. Who knows the client could be programmed into a specially burned disc but without the pc it would be sort of a problem because while it would still work you would have to play in the same time and talk it out while the pc client would help with all that.
This is of course for two players or more games only where there are two horizontal or vertical screen on both televisions split.
The dongle also has wifi & bluetooth and an extra simcard slot which might help those with no access to anything else.
Host & Player or more players are both hardware-wise slot 2 but in reality in software the host chooses first while the player is second.
PS1 Netplay Dongle for Controller Port 2 (Idea)
-
- What is PSXDEV?
- Posts: 2
- Joined: May 29th, 2022, 9:16 pm
- PlayStation Model: SCPH-9002
- Discord: markhoss#1498
- Location: Czech Republic
A microprocessor or microcontroller could handle the syncing kind of like some raspberry pi project or risc-v for the input between the two they would also talk together between two consoles and manage it that way even while online globally on a different country, everything csn be soldered these days and after there are even softmods if it can be done through emulation it must be possible through real hardware, thanks for reading and wishing me to get well. 

-
gwald Verified
- Net Yaroze Enthusiast
- Posts: 342
- Joined: September 18th, 2013, 8:44 am
- I am a: programmer/DBA
- PlayStation Model: Net Yaroze
- Contact:
Emulators cheat because they can do anything via software
I'm not a hardware guy or do any low level stuff but memcard/controller port does have a timing signal for light guns, so the device could just count those.
This is what software receives from the hardware
https://problemkaputt.de/psx-spx.htm#co ... emorycards
There's also the picomemcard project which use the same port.
https://github.com/dangiu/PicoMemcard
I don't think there's any point to connecting to a computer, it's just as easy writing a PSX program that creates a memcard save with settings, (ie IP:port) that the memcard/controller device would read.
Or it could be a launcher program via CDROM or cheat cart.
I think it's very doable and I think people would use it

I'm not a hardware guy or do any low level stuff but memcard/controller port does have a timing signal for light guns, so the device could just count those.
This is what software receives from the hardware
https://problemkaputt.de/psx-spx.htm#co ... emorycards
There's also the picomemcard project which use the same port.
https://github.com/dangiu/PicoMemcard
I don't think there's any point to connecting to a computer, it's just as easy writing a PSX program that creates a memcard save with settings, (ie IP:port) that the memcard/controller device would read.
Or it could be a launcher program via CDROM or cheat cart.
I think it's very doable and I think people would use it

On a SNES, that would be done via hardware like X-Band Modem. That is, not a simple thing, and with handcrafted time-sync patches for each game, and with the hardware supporting to automatically install those patches, but how would you do that via controller port???
And the SNES is a system with relative robust timings: With ROM cartridge loading, and without major hardware revisions. On the PSX, the CDROM loading speeds are adding a bit more randomness, and there are two GPU versions with different rendering times. I am sure that the timings would derail before anything.
And the SNES is a system with relative robust timings: With ROM cartridge loading, and without major hardware revisions. On the PSX, the CDROM loading speeds are adding a bit more randomness, and there are two GPU versions with different rendering times. I am sure that the timings would derail before anything.
Who is online
Users browsing this forum: No registered users and 8 guests